/// <summary> /// 请求错误 /// </summary> /// <param name="obj">返回的数据</param> /// <returns></returns> public static Result <T> Error(T obj) { Result <T> result = new Result <T>(); result.Code = (int)ResultCode.Error; result.Msg = EnumExtension.GetEnumDescriptionName(ResultCode.Error); result.Details = obj; return(result); }
/// <summary> /// 不在服务时间 /// </summary> /// <param name="obj"></param> /// <returns></returns> public static Result <T> NotTime(T obj) { Result <T> result = new Result <T>(); result.Code = (int)ResultCode.SysFix; result.Msg = EnumExtension.GetEnumDescriptionName(ResultCode.NotTime); result.Details = obj; return(result); }
public ErrorResult(ErrorCode code) { this.ErrorCode = (int)code; this.ErrorMsg = EnumExtension.GetEnumDescriptionName(code); }
public FailResult(FailCode code) { this.FailCode = (int)code; this.FailMsg = EnumExtension.GetEnumDescriptionName(code); }
public SuccessResult(SuccessCode code) { this.SuccessCode = (int)code; this.SuccessMsg = EnumExtension.GetEnumDescriptionName(code); }